框架内置服务

一 页面相关Page:

  • alert(message, okCallback)alert提示,参数分别为提示信息、回调函数

  • notice(message)notice消息提示,2s后自动消失

  • confirm(message, okCallback)confirm选择

  • ajax(method, url, data, isFilter, callback, errorCallback)ajax请求,参数分别为请求方式(GET|POST|PUT|DELETE)、请求url、json类型参数、是否显示请求等待提示、回调函数、错误回调函数。下面是对4中请求类型的封装:

  • ajaxPost(url, data, callback, errorCallback)

  • ajaxPostQuiet(url, data, callback, errorCallback)

  • ajaxGet(url, data, callback, errorCallback)

  • ajaxGetQuiet(url, data, callback, errorCallback)

  • ajaxPut(url, data, callback, errorCallback)

  • ajaxDelete(url, data, callback, errorCallback)

二 form相关Form:

  • toJson(formid, params)将form表单的值转换为json,如果提供params参数,则返回params和form表单的合集

  • toJson(formid, params)包含form表单里的空值

三 code相关XCode:

  • getName(codeType, value)获取codeType类型的value对应的name

  • getSelectOption(codeType)获取codeType类型下来值array

四 ztree相关Ztree:

  • Ztree.unCheckAllNodes(dest)// 取消选择

  • Ztree.checkNodes(dest, nodes, idKey)// 选择节点

  • Ztree.difference(nodes1, nodes2, idKey)// 获取nodes2相对于nodes1减少的

  • Ztree.ids(nodes, idKey)// 获取id数组

  • Ztree.getData(item)// 获取节点json数据,去掉Ztree内置的属性和方法

版权及转载说明

本站原创、转载文章欢迎任何形式的转载,但请务必注明出处,尊重他人劳动共创开源社区

本站转载文章版权归原作者所有,如发现本站文章涉嫌侵权请点击「联系我们」反馈,本站将给予删除